About me
Dr. V. Bhuvaneswari completed her Bachelor Degree in Mechanical Engineering in the year of 2004. Finished her master's in Computer Aided Design in the year of 2013 and secured First Class in both degrees. She completed her Ph.D. in the area of Materials science during 2022. So far she has published 14 journals and participated around 15 in both National and International Conferences. Her highest impact factor publication is in Archives of Computational Methods in Engineering with 7.302 impact factor. She filed 11 patents so far which are in published status and 4 of her patents got Granted.
